Mother’s Day brings 14% rise in weekly sales for John Lewis
Photo credit: John Lewis plc

Total sales rose 14.3 per cent year-on-year for John Lewis, as an early Mother’s Day boosted a strong set of results across the partnership’s UK stores. All of John Lewis’ selling branches reported increases on last year, with Swindon leading the way yet again with a 28 per cent rise in sales, Chester close behind with a 25 per cent increase and Milton Keynes up 22 per cent as shoppers made the most of its full refurbishment.

John Lewis criticised over supplier rebate
Photo Credit: My Retail Media

Leading department store chain John Lewis has been criticised after announcing that its suppliers will be subject to a rebate, with the amount being dependent on the rate of the sales increase of each supplier. The Telegraph reported that John Lewis issued a letter to its suppliers stating that, effective from the beginning of last month, the scheme will impose a reduction on each supplier’s annual invoice, with the total linked to their rate of sales growth.

John Lewis set to raise staff bonuses
Photo credit: John Lewis plc

John Lewis Partnership is expected to raise its staff bonuses of up to 16 per cent of their salary next week as the retailer’s profits go from strength to strength. The employee- owned UK partnership, which operates John Lewis department stores and Waitrose supermarkets, last year gave its 81,000 employees a bonus of 14 per cent from a pot of £165.2 million.

John Lewis joins Collect+ scheme, allowing customers to pick up deliveries at corner shop
Photo credit: My Retail Media

John Lewis is preparing for a dramatic expansion of its online shopping operations as it joins the Collect+ scheme. Shoppers will soon be able to pick up and return items bought on the John Lewis website at up to 5,000 independent retailers. From this autumn, John Lewis customers in Scotland, Northern Ireland and south-west England will be able to collect items at about 1,000 outlets for a charge of £3.

Department stores reap the rewards as shoppers spend 12% more online in 2012

A survey by Barclaycard found shoppers spent 12.8 per cent more online in 2012, accounting for nearly one-fifth of all retail transactions. Department stores proved to be one of the biggest areas for growth in online shopping, rising 37 per cent online, with John Lewis recording its best web year to date.
